Systems Unit/Network Planning Department

The FMTIS Systems Unit (SystE) is responsible for technology and equipment in the Armed Forces' fixed command support systems, technical and infrastructural design, and architecture of the joint defense information infrastructure. The Network Planning Department, where the position is located, is responsible for the development of the Armed Forces' fixed telecommunications network (FTN). We have about 50 employees located in several locations.

The Swedish Armed Forces' telecommunications and information systems unit, FMTIS, ensures the Armed Forces' ability to communicate and lead - around the clock, year-round.

The unit has a collective responsibility for the Armed Forces' technical command systems that support military operations at sea, on land, and in the air - in Sweden and abroad. The unit has nearly 2000 employees at more than 32 locations across the country. Read more at https://jobb.forsvarsmakten.se/fmtis (https://jobb.forsvarsmakten.se/fmtis)

Employment with us means placement in a security class. Usually, Swedish citizenship is required. A security check with a background check will be conducted before employment according to Chapter 3 of the Security Protection Act. Employment comes with an obligation to be placed in wartime and to serve abroad. The implications of this vary depending on the type of position.
